Meeting the 501 Loan Requirements & Documentation



Securing a 501 loan for your nonprofit organization can seem complex, but being prepared with the necessary documentation is key. Usually, lenders will want to see a comprehensive business plan, detailing how the funds will be used to further your mission. This includes a clear budget forecast, demonstrating your financial sustainability. You’ll also need to provide proof of your 501(c)(3) classification, often including your IRS determination document. Furthermore, lenders often request recent financial reports, such as balance sheets and income records, and board assembly minutes. Finally, be prepared to present details about your service offerings, including statistics that show your influence on the community you serve. Failing to have these elements in order could lead to here delays in the approval process.
